Is it possible to operate at 38.4kbps with 11,0952MHz clock? or what crystal should be used for that?

Re: 8051 and 38.4kbps The crystal frequency is very good, cause 8051 baud rate generator can achieve rates of fosc/(32•n), with n = 9 how get 38.4k.

8051 and 38.4kbps Strictly speaking, this is possible only with 8052, using timer2 as the baudrate generator. The vast majority of today's '51 derivatives do have timer2 (or even an independent baudrate generator), the notable exception is AT89C2051. See also https://www.keil.com/products/c51/baudrate.asp
